The Gazan Civil Defense spokesman, Mahmoud Basal, reported that 19 people lost their lives and 36 injured as a result of Israeli attacks against Palestine during the delay of the ceasefire, of approximately three hours, until 11:30 (local time), when the agreement between Hamas and the Zionist entity came into force, as highlighted by Al Jazeera.

According to a statement quoted by the media, one person died in Rafah, six in Khan Younis, nine in Gaza City and three in the northern area.

For its part, the Palestinian news agency Wafa reported heavy air strikes at several sites in the enclave starting in the early hours of this Sunday.

In addition, medical sources recorded the death of 11 people as a result of attacks in Beit Lahiya, Gaza and Al-Bureij. In addition, Beit Hanoun and other areas of northern Gaza were also the scene of Israeli bombings.

On January 19, the surroundings of Al-Quds Hospital woke up under fire and Israeli troops attacked places close to medical facilities.
